INSTRUCTIONS:
The Junction can be found at 136 E Rosemary Street, housed within the large glass building once known as the ‘Bank of America Building.’ Our main doors are opposite of the brand new parking garage off of Rosemary Street!

Please note that the parking garage operates on metered parking managed by the town of Chapel Hill. To streamline payment, we suggest downloading the PARKMOBILE APP in advance, enabling easy payment and the option to extend parking time.

Alternatively, multiple parking payment stations are available within the garage. For visuals, please reference the photo for parking and entrance map.

Please note, though you may have entered the building through Franklin Street before, those are not our main doors and we do not have access to unlock. Please enter the Junction through our main doors off of Rosemary Street.

Transportation

Park

The closest parking is the new Parking Deck at 125 East Rosemary Street in Chapel Hill. This new deck has over 1,000 parking spots. Alternativley you can park at the old Wallace Deck at 150 E Rosemary St. To view more detailed directions, click below.

RATES:
• 12-hour workday: 140/month.
• 24-hour: $175/month.
• Free for 30 minutes or less.
• $1 per hour within two hours.
• $2 per hour beyond two hours.
• $18 daily maximum.
• $30 special event parking.

For more information, please send an email to parking@townofchapelhill.org and include "Innovate UNC" in the subject line.

Bus

You’ll find plenty of ways to travel to the downtown hub by bus.

The Town of Chapel Hill operates bus transportation on regular routes and a demand-response service throughout Chapel Hill and Carrboro. This includes connecting routes to GoTriangle, the regional transit provider.
